Temporary Closure Of Restaurant For Selling Food Not Suitable For Consumption

DOHA: The Al-Rayyan Municipality issued an administrative decision to close the 'Sator Al-Qassab' restaurant for 7 days for violating Law No.8 of 1990 on the regulation of human food control. The restaurant will be temporarily closed over selling food not suitable for consumption. 

Ministry Of Municipality routinely conducts inspections and takes action against violators. The list of violators and the duration of punishment are listed on their website. 

To date, over 1,100 establishments were closed for various violations. Determining the duration of the closure is up to the discretion of the municipality depending on the type and severity of the violation as determined by law. 

It is not permissible to open closed stores or restaurants or to carry out the activity or do maintenance during the closing period and violating this will entail criminal liability.
